Rigetti Computing Reports Q4 Revenue and Key Partnership

Rigetti Computing’s Fourth Quarter Financial Overview
Rigetti Computing Inc, known for its pioneering work in quantum computing, recently shared its financial results for the fourth quarter. The reported revenue was $2.3 million, falling short of analyst expectations, which were set at $2.5 million. The company’s performance reflects the challenges in the evolving quantum computing market, yet it remains poised for growth.
Understanding Rigetti's Financial Position
For the entire fiscal year, Rigetti recorded revenues totaling $10.8 million and reported a significant net loss of $201 million. This loss highlights the vast investments required in the quantum sector's cutting-edge technology. However, Rigetti concluded the year with cash reserves of $217.2 million, indicating a robust financial foundation which enables further innovation and development.
Insight to Earnings Report
In its latest earnings briefing, Rigetti also shared adjusted earnings per share, which reflected a loss of eight cents. This figure aligns with initial estimates and signifies that while revenues fell short, their cost management may have held steady. The company's strategic endeavors will be vital as it looks to bridge the gap towards profitable quarters ahead.
Strategic Collaboration with Quanta Computer
Partnership Announcement
In a notable move for the company, Rigetti announced a strategic partnership with Quanta Computer, a major player in the global technology landscape. Signed recently, this collaboration is expected to enhance Rigetti's capabilities significantly. Both companies have pledged to invest over $100 million into their joint vision over the next five years, underscoring their commitment to innovation in quantum computing.
Implications of the Partnership
Quanta's substantial investment of $35 million into Rigetti’s shares not only strengthens the financial backing of Rigetti but also signals confidence in the future of quantum computing. Dr. Subodh Kulkarni, CEO of Rigetti, has expressed enthusiasm for this alliance, indicating it will help both companies maintain a competitive edge in a rapidly evolving technological landscape.
Technological Innovations of Rigetti
Upon reinforcing its financial positioning and strategic partnerships, Rigetti has made waves with its latest technological advancements, notably the launch of the 84-qubit Ankaa-3 system in late 2024. This system represents a significant achievement in the field and expands access to cutting-edge quantum processing power through Rigetti's Quantum Cloud Services, as well as platforms like Amazon Bracket and Microsoft Azure.
Current Market Position of RGTI
As of the latest trading sessions, Rigetti’s stock (RGTI) experienced a decline, trading down 4.89% at $7.78. This decline may be attributed to the mixed results from the quarterly earnings report and broader market sentiments. The stock has fluctuated between $0.66 and $21.42 over the past year, demonstrating the volatility often seen in tech stocks.
